DDN: Wright State picked third in HL preseason poll, put two on all-league team

Wright State was picked third in the Horizon League preseason poll Wednesday in a vote of 40 coaches, sports information directors and media, while Purdue Fort Wayne was favored slightly over Northern Kentucky to win the crown.

And while it’s an educated guess with so many transfers shuffling in and out, Raiders coach Scott Nagy was incredulous over his team getting so much respect from prognosticators.

“I’m trying to figure out what they’re looking at,” he said. “That’s way higher than I would have thought. We lost two guys who averaged about 40 points for us.

“But it all shakes out differently anyway. It did last year.”

The Raiders lost two players to major-conference schools in Tanner Holden (20.1 average) and Grant Basile (18.5), but, after being picked second in the preseason poll last year, they won the conference tourney and an NCAA game.

Plus, they didn’t just stand pat after those departures. Among the newcomers is senior guard Amari Davis, a former HL freshman of the year. He joined teammate Trey Calvin on the preseason all-league second team.
